Introduction to Formoterol Fumarate Inhaler

The Formoterol Fumarate Inhaler treats respiratory issues, offering hope to patients with conditions like asthma and COPD (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ease). This inhaler contains formoterol, a bronchodilator known for its quick and lasting effectiveness.

  • Overview of Formoterol as a Medication: Formoterol is unique for its lasting effects and belongs to the class of beta2 agonist medications. It works by relaxing the muscles around the airways, countering the narrowing that occurs during flare-ups.
  • Importance in Respiratory Treatment Plans: Including formoterol in treatment plans is essential not only for immediate relief but also for long-term management strategies that aim to improve lung function and quality of life.

 

Composition and Characteristics of Formoterol Fumarate Inhaler

The Formoterol Fumarate Inhaler is carefully crafted with a combination of elements to improve its effectiveness and make it easier for users to follow. Its ingredients and delivery method are customized to meet the needs of patients with respiratory issues.

  • Key Components and Their Functions: The core element of this inhaler is formoterol dihydrate, which quickly widens the airways and provides lasting relief from breathing difficulties.
  • Varieties and Administration Techniques: Offered in forms like dry powder inhalers and metered dose inhalers, each type ensures that the active ingredient reaches the lungs, effectively maximizing its benefits.

 

How Formoterol Fumarate Works

Understanding how formoterol fumarate works illuminates its effectiveness in treating airway conditions. The inhaler's design ensures that the medicine targets the lungs while minimizing exposure to the rest of the body.

  • In the lungs, formoterol interacts with adrenergic receptors in the smooth muscles, causing relaxation and widening of the airways. This results in decreased breathing resistance and improved airflow.

Interaction With Other Medications

Formoterol Fumarate Inhaler, like any medication, may have interactions with different drugs that could change how it works or raise the chances of adverse reactions.

  • Notable drug interactions to be aware of are beta-blockers, which might reduce formoterol's effectiveness, and certain diuretics, which could lead to hypokalemia risks. Physicians typically handle these interactions by monitoring how patients respond or adjusting medication doses accordingly.
  • The use of over-the-counter medications and supplements can also impact formoterol. For example, products containing caffeine or pseudoephedrine might worsen side effects such as heart palpitations or feelings of nervousness. Patients should seek advice from their healthcare provider before introducing any medication or supplement into their routine.

 

Side Effects of Formoterol Fumarate

While formoterol fumarate is effective in treating conditions, it may lead to varying side effects.

  • Managing Common Side Effects: Typical reactions, such as headaches, throat irritation, and muscle cramps, are usually mild. They can be addressed through supportive care or adjusting the dosage.
  • Recognizing Serious Adverse Reactions: Severe symptoms such as chest pain, rapid heart rate, or intense wheezing require immediate medical attention. Patients should be informed about these side effects to enable prompt action.

Managing Overdosage and Emergencies

Managing an overdose of Formoterol Fumarate Inhaler is crucial to avoid complications. Symptoms of an overdose may include palpitations, headaches, tremors, and high blood sugar levels.

  • If these symptoms occur it is important to stop taking the medication and seek urgent medical attention to minimize the effects and prevent any further complications.
  • When a dose is missed, patients should take it as soon as they remember unless it is almost time for their next scheduled dose. In such cases, it is recommended to skip the missed dose and resume the regular dosing schedule. Avoiding doses is advised to prevent any potential risks.
